## Key Ceremony Checklist — Item 7: Thumbnail Queue Signing Key

Before rotating the signing key for the Milldown thumbnail generation queue, confirm that all pending render jobs have drained and the Quarrow workers report idle. Support should notify requesters that thumbnail delivery pauses for roughly ten minutes. Two ceremony witnesses must initial the log sheet. To unlock the ceremony workstation's sealed keystore, the attending officer enters the recovery passphrase recorded just below.

vault phrase of bagaf-kajeg = jorath-feniel-briir-siliel-ralix

## Data stores

The Renderloft transcoding farm uses two stores: a queue table tracking every job's state (queued, encoding, failed, done) and an object store for output segments. Workers heartbeat into the queue table every 10 seconds; stale rows are requeued automatically. Maintainers can inspect job state directly using the connection string below.

primary connection of yagag-kaguf = mssql://praox_svc:wUPY5WS@db-c12a.sivrelio.corp:5432/gordor

- [ ] Step 7: Archive cold storage buckets (Glacierline tier). Confirm both ceremony witnesses are present, verify bucket manifests match the Oxbow ledger, then seal the archive key shares. Plugin authors may observe but not handle shares. Once sealed, the archive index itself is encrypted and can only be reopened with the passphrase below.

vault phrase of badup-hahig = tamael-aldael-kelmir-istael-fenok-istwyn-tamius-jorath-oliion

First, every command implements both `apply` and `revert`, and `revert(apply(state))` is byte-identical to the original state. Second, compound gestures (drag-resize, multi-select move) must register as a single stack entry, never per-frame. Third, the redo stack clears on any new command, including programmatic ones from the layout assistant. Violations here corrupt collaborative sessions in ways that only surface days later. The full invariant checklist is maintained on our internal page.

operations page: https://jenkins.zemvarcloud.local/job/merge_requests/repo/build/73930b4b30f0a8ed